Output 26429653733eee917b330c6631c4dfd7de0c6ff99fe5adbf94a0a24d7e752079:2

value
39110192
script pubkey
OP_0 OP_PUSHBYTES_20 c3d573235c0e49f432db164856e788865227e0c5
address
ltc1qc02hxg6upeylgvkmzey9deugsefz0cx977g074
transaction
26429653733eee917b330c6631c4dfd7de0c6ff99fe5adbf94a0a24d7e752079
spent
true